Piracy websites are rarely secure. They operate via third-party advertising networks that utilize malicious pop-ups, adware, and hidden links. Clicking a "Download" button on Filmyzilla frequently triggers automatic downloads of malware, spyware, or ransomware that can compromise personal data, passwords, and banking information on phones or computers. 2. Spirituality and faith are also central to the film, as Pi's experiences on the lifeboat lead him to question his own spirituality and the existence of God. The film's use of magical realism, a literary device that combines realistic descriptions of everyday life with magical or fantastical elements, adds depth and complexity to the narrative.
A major feature is the realistic creation of Richard Parker , the Royal Bengal tiger. The animation is so seamless that critics describe it as a "masterful visual effect" that builds a believable relationship between the tiger and the protagonist, Pi.
